It is that time of the year and our students are getting ready for a well deserve break.
In the past weeks our students have been consolidating their Spanish language learning
participating in class activities that involved dancing, singing and role playing.
Prep to year 2 Students continued practicing vocabulary such as:
- Hola (Hello) to the teacher and class piers
- Buenos días (Good morning)
- Singing and dancing to head, shoulders, knees and toes in Spanish.
- Using the school-based app to practice numbers, colours and directions in Spanish.
We have also been learning how to express our feelings in Spanish and students worked on a clock that enable them to show the teacher how they feel during the Spanish lessons
Years 3 and 4 ongoing weekly lessons.
Student continue practicing their Spanish vocabulary such as:
Greeting teachers and peers in Spanish
- Hola, Buenos días, Adios
Asking and responding simple questions in Spanish:
- ¿Cómo estas? (Hoe are you)
- ¿Cómo te llamas? (What is your name)
- ¿Cuántos años tienes? (How old are you?)
- Puedo ir al baño? (Can I go to the toilet?)
- Adiós” and waving goodbye
In the past week’s students have been learning and practicing the 5 W’s and one H in Spanish, making and playing a chatterbox game in order to reinforce their Spanish vocabulary.
